HSB 647 — A Bill For An Act Relating To Chatbots, Including Deployer Requirements And Interactions With Minors
HSB 647 introduces requirements for chatbot deployers in Iowa, focusing on protecting minors from harmful interactions with AI systems. The bill addresses concerns about chatbots influencing minors and includes provisions for deployer accountability. It falls under the state's 2025-2026 legislative session and has been renumbered as HF 2715 after receiving a committee report approving the bill.
